Special notice for VPS/VDS installs:
After the install, add:

ethernet_dev=eth0:devicename

to /usr/local/directadmin/conf/directadmin.conf.

Replace devicename with the FULL devicename reported by ifconfig. If your VDS/VPS system emulates eth0, then you may skip this step.
